What is Bookmap?

bookmap.com website

Bookmap is an advanced trading platform developed by a synergistic collaboration between seasoned traders and adept software developers. Launched in 2014, Bookmap provides traders with a unique perspective into market dynamics by focusing on real-time data visualization.

Through its innovative heatmap feature, it offers an in-depth and highly accurate view of the market, highlighting the intricate interaction between buyers and sellers. The platform, aptly named from its core features, OrderBOOK and HeatMAP, illuminates the full depth of the market, ensuring traders receive a comprehensive and unfiltered analysis.

By concentrating on precision and depth, Bookmap stands as a paramount choice for day traders, scalpers, and algorithmic traders who seek a clear edge in the trading arena.

Bookmap Pricing

Bookmap offers four different subscription levels to suit the needs and budgets of different traders. The plans available include:

  • Digital: The most basic plan, offered for free. It includes access to delayed market data, volume dots, and price levels.
  • Digital Plus: For $19/mo, this plan includes everything in the Digital plan, plus access to additional market data providers and the ability to customize the interface.
  • Global: For $49/mo, this plan includes everything in the Digital Plus plan, as well as access to market replay and additional market data sources.
  • Global Plus: For $99/mo, this is the most comprehensive plan offered by Bookmap. It includes everything in the Global plan, plus access to advanced market data analysis tools and personalized training sessions.

With so many plans, there should be a plan in everyone’s price range. It should be noted users can save 20% on subscription costs by paying yearly.

Order Flow

bookmap order flow

Bookmap offers an unparalleled glimpse into order flow, refreshing its data a remarkable 40 times every second. This ensures traders receive near-instantaneous insights into current market activities.

Complementing this rapid update is Bookmap’s stellar visualization arsenal, including intuitive heatmaps and Volume Bubbles. This combination facilitates quick information assimilation, enabling prompt action.

Current Order Book

bookmap current order book

Bookmap’s Current Order Book (COB) provides a visual portrayal of pending orders in real-time. This graphical interface allows traders to understand support and resistance levels for their chosen asset, revealing liquidity at different price tiers. Such a display can be invaluable in pinpointing market opportunities.

Located to the graph’s right, this order book employs a colormap to illustrate historical orders. While red and green are the default color choices, customization allows for a range of hues to cater to individual preferences.

Whether you’re examining in terms of numbers or percentages, or exploring the aggregate or extended display options, Bookmap ensures clarity and efficiency in presenting the current order landscape.

Analytical Indicators

bookmap indicators

Bookmap stands out with its tailored analytical indicators designed for interpreting market liquidity. Unlike traditional metrics like RSI or Bollinger Bands, Bookmap focuses on real-time order book insights.

The Imbalance Tracker offers a snapshot of current order book disparities, serving as an accurate gauge of market sentiment. Paired with Bookmap’s fast data retrieval, traders can quickly identify and act upon market anomalies.

For day traders, the Strength Level Indicator illuminates liquidity depth by showcasing transaction volumes within set periods. Meanwhile, the Large Lot Tracker reveals the big players in the market by highlighting those with the most substantial contract volumes.

The Stops & Icebergs Tracker offers insights into major market participants’ strategies, pinpointing fragmented orders. It not only signals emerging opportunities but also acts as a shield against market manipulations like spoofing.

Broker Compatibility

Bookmap provides compatibility with a select range of brokers for trading assets like stocks and futures. Among the notable brokers supported are Interactive Brokers, TradeStation, dxFeed, and Rithmic. Those using platforms such as TD Ameritrade’s Thinkorswim can also incorporate Bookmap for enhanced functionality.

Bookmap supports the crypto market, offering integration with leading crypto exchanges like Coinbase, Binance, and Kraken. The fact that they support Cryptocurrency trading shows that Bookmap is a cutting-edge trading platform.

For those looking to trade live, linking the software to an API or a brokerage account is essential.

This is crucial for executing orders across stocks, ETFs, futures, and cryptocurrencies. To access trading capabilities for certain assets, a paid subscription becomes necessary.

It’s worth noting that while Bookmap’s broker compatibility list isn’t exhaustive, it does support approximately 30 data feeds and brokerage firms.
